About the Role

Gap Inc. is a leader in digitally powered commerce and connected experiences. Together, our iconic brands form a multi-brand, omnichannel engine that reaches millions of customers and associates across channels and touchpoints.

You will report to the SVP, Chief Product Officer, serving as the backbone of our product organization. This is not a back-office operations role — it's the engine that ensures our product vision is understood, connected, and activated across teams.

Our product organization is structured around three core journeys: Customer (shopping experiences across digital and in-store), Product (creating and distributing our apparel), and Enterprise (critical operating functions like finance, HR, and corporate systems). Each journey has its own product leadership. Your role is to ensure alignment and connection across all three — translating strategy into operational rhythm, not setting the strategy itself.
As Senior Director, Product Transformation & Enablement you will own the product org's operating model and cadence: what's centralized, what's federated to journey teams, and how it all connects. You'll orchestrate cross-journey alignment, elevate the craft of product management, steward our strategic partner relationships, and shape how the product org communicates its impact to the broader enterprise and executive leadership.

This is a pivotal leadership role for someone who moves fluidly between boardroom context and operational detail — equally comfortable absorbing a CPO-level conversation and translating it into action across teams. You bring strong facilitation skills, financial acumen, and the judgment to know which rooms we need to be in.
What You'll Do

Operating Model & Strategic Orchestration

Facilitate the design of the product org's operating model: planning cycles, calendars, and rhythms that keep the portfolio aligned to strategy. Orchestrate the translation of CPO-level strategy into operational plans, KPIs, and measurable outcomes across our Customer, Product, and Enterprise journeys. You're not the strategist. You're the one making sure strategy is activated across teams. Keep the organization looking forward by surfacing emerging trends, facilitating innovation sprints, and connecting the CPO to insights that inform strategic direction.

Communications & Storytelling

Own the airwaves. Shape how the product org tells its story, both internally within the team and outward to the broader enterprise, business partners, and executive leadership. Develop clear, data-driven executive narratives that articulate digital priorities, investment rationale, and enterprise impact. Bring together the broader story with strong direction and input from Journey Leads. Deliver compelling communications across written, video, and oral formats.

Forums, Events & Leadership Presence

Own our product management townhalls and ensure we are prepared and represented in the right leadership forums and cross-functional conversations, including GTS-wide and brand/function townhalls as needed. Pull us into the right rooms.

Product Management Craft

Build competency models that define what great product management looks like at Gap Inc. Partner with coaches and leaders across our three journey teams to raise the bar on PdM practice and close the gap between where we are and industry best-in-class. Drive continuous improvement in how teams work through scalable processes and delivery best practices.

Financial Stewardship

Partner with finance to monitor org-level spend and investment trends. Establish reporting frameworks that increase transparency into product health and resource allocation. Flag when things are off track and help drive course corrections.

Strategic Partner Management

Manage executive-level relationships with our top ~10 strategic technology and services partners. Establish the right cadence of executive briefings and ensure we're getting maximum value from those partnerships.
